Description

THE PROPERTY This detached bungalow is situated in a quiet cul-de-sac in the popular location of Bevelin Hall. The property benefits from gas fired central heating and double glazing and is very well presented throughout with accommodation comprising Entrance Hall, Kitchen/Living Room, Family Bathroom and Three Bedrooms - master with en-suite. There are gardens to front and rear and off street parking on the front driveway. Saundersfoot, a very popular resort, is renowned for its beautiful sandy beaches, pretty working harbour and a selection of cafes, pubs and restaurants. The bungalow would make an ideal family or holiday home.

HALL/SITTING AREA Enter via uPVC French doors from the front drive. Laminate flooring. Doors to kitchen and master suite. Built-in storage cupboard.

KITCHEN 2.92m(9'7") x 2.62m(8'7") Accessed via multi pane door from hall. Fitted with an attractive range of timber fronted units with matching worktop and tiled splashback. Built-in oven and gas hob with extractor hood over. Inset 1.5 bowl stainless steel sink and drainer. Integral fridge and freezer, washing machine and dishwasher. Tiled floor. Inset spotlights. Window to front with views over to the coast.

KITCHEN & DINING AREA

LIVING ROOM 5.97m(19'7") x 3.99m(13'1") +dining recess Open plan from the kitchen. Windows to front. Lounge with feature fireplace and laminate flooring. Door to rear hall.

REAR HALL Access to bedrooms two and three and family bathroom.

FAMILY BATHROOM Fitted with suite comprising WC, pedestal wash hand basin and panelled bath with electric shower over and folding shower screen. Fully tiled walls and floor. Velux window. Shelved alcove. Built-in airing cupboard with fitted radiator.

BEDROOM 2 5.56m(18'3") max x 3.63m(11'11") Window to rear overlooking the garden. Buit-in wardrobe.

 

BEDROOM 3 4.32m(14'2") x 2.84m(9'4") Window to rear. Door to rear garden. Laminate flooring. Built-in wardrobe.

REVERSE VIEW

MASTER BEDROOM 4.06m(13'4") x 2.59m(8'6") +door recess Accessed via door from hall. Built-in double wardrobe. Door to en-suite.

EN-SUITE Fitted with WC, pedestal wash hand basin and corner shower enclosure. Window to side.

EXTERNALLY Lawned garden and driveway to front. Rear garden has decked area, lawn and storage shed.

DIRECTIONS From Tenby proceed north to the roundabout at New Hedges. Continue straight across and take the first right turn into Sandyhill Road. On reaching the brow of the hill turn right into Sandyhill Park then left into Bevelin Hall. Follow the road down and take the second left. No 37 will be found on the left hand side.
